Angela is a licensed Missouri salesperson who has been working at Pinnacle Realty for three years. Her broker, without Angela's knowledge, has been commingling client trust funds with the brokerage's operating account. MREC investigates and determines that Angela had no knowledge of or participation in the commingling. Under Missouri law, which of the following most accurately describes the broker's liability and Angela's status?

Correct Answer

B) The broker faces disciplinary action for the trust account violation; Angela faces no disciplinary action because she had no knowledge or participation

Under RSMo Chapter 339, the broker bears primary responsibility for trust account management and compliance. Commingling client funds with operating accounts is a serious violation subject to MREC disciplinary action against the broker. Because Angela had no knowledge of or participation in the violation, she does not share the broker's disciplinary liability. Missouri's supervisory framework places non-delegable trust account duties on the broker, not on affiliated salespersons.
